F.E. Warren Fire Department honored with international accreditation
F.E. Warren Fire Department and Emergency Services Assistant Fire Chief Joshua Steen (left) and Fire Chief Joshua Sarters (second from left) receive a plaque commemorating their third consecutive International Accreditation Status at a hearing held by Fire Accreditation International in Orlando, Fla., Feb. 28, 2024. The Warren Fire Department earned the accreditation through the exemplification of a well-organized and strategic minded organization with proper staffing, equipping and training. The department is the only one in Air Force Global Strike Command or the state of Wyoming with the accreditation. (courtesy photo)
